In today's world, energy conservation is no longer an option but a necessity. With companies looking for ways to cut costs and reduce their carbon footprint, the importance of industrial energy audits cannot be overstated. But what exactly is an industrial energy audit? It involves a systematic examination of all the energy-consuming systems in an industrial setup to identify opportunities for energy savings and improve efficiency.

Walk-Through Audit
During walk-through audits, Energy Auditors in Delhi quickly overview energy systems and assess electricity consumption using the best process energy audits. These audits are cost-effective for suggesting small changes and tips to reduce energy bills. The focus is on heating, cooling, ventilation, and appliances to identify energy-saving opportunities.
